About Company
INVasset LLP
INVasset LLP is an investment firm dedicated to guiding individuals toward achieving financial freedom through a disciplined approach to wealth creation. Their philosophy centers on identifying and investing in high-performing businesses and resilient management teams that demonstrate long-term growth potential. By focusing on sustainable value generation, the firm aims to deliver robust returns for its clients, targeting significant capital appreciation—specifically aiming for 1.5x to 2.0x growth over a 3-to-4-year horizon. Through this strategic, research-backed methodology, INVasset LLP seeks to provide investors with a reliable pathway to building lasting wealth within the framework of their professional portfolio management services.

Rajnish Garg
Rajnish Garg is one of the most respected names in the stock market fraternity in North India.
He is a Chartered Accountant & Company Secretary and has 30+ years of wealth creating experience in the stock market. An ardent investor, Rajnish is known for his investing techniques & strong grasp of market fundamentals This unique blend has enabled him to create long term sustainable wealth for his clients and stakeholders.
He conceptualized the philosophy behind Invasset AAID (Advanced Algorithms for Investment Decisions), our Proprietary In House Research Model which led to recognition of Invasset as best Multicap PMS in India for the calendar year 2023.
